The O-Shot, a revolutionary treatment in the field of medical aesthetics, has gained significant attention for its potential benefits in enhancing sexual health and rejuvenating the vaginal area. When considering the O-Shot in Lower Hutt, one of the most common questions among potential patients is the healing time associated with the procedure.
The O-Shot involves the injection of platelet-rich plasma (PRP) into the vaginal area, which stimulates tissue regeneration and improves blood flow. The procedure itself is relatively quick, typically taking about 30 minutes to complete. Post-treatment, patients can expect some mild discomfort, similar to what one might experience after a routine injection. This may include slight tenderness or swelling in the treated area, which is normal and should subside within a few days.
Most patients report feeling back to their usual selves within 24 to 48 hours after the O-Shot. However, it's important to note that individual healing times can vary based on factors such as overall health, age, and how well the body responds to the treatment. It's recommended to avoid strenuous activities, including sexual intercourse, for at least 24 hours post-procedure to allow the area to heal properly.
In summary, the healing time for the O-Shot in Lower Hutt is generally short, with most patients experiencing minimal downtime.
